The Background and Evolution of Canvas Wall Tents
For generations, canvas camping tents have made a track record for their longevity. Their all-natural sturdy nature stands strongly versus high winds, hefty rainfalls and thick snow.


They're also breathable, which assists manage temperature and keeps condensation to a minimum. This is a massive benefit in environments with extensively varying night and day temperature levels.

Origins
Canvas is a hefty, thick product constructed from pressed cotton and hemp or flax fibers. It has a wonderful strength-to-weight ratio and is exceptionally sturdy. It's also breathable, making it a suitable selection for tent camping.

In the 1800s, as leaders took a trip westward, they sought out the security and convenience supplied by canvas wall camping tents. They were simple to establish and can endure the aspects, making them a preferred alternative for campers.

The next significant modification to the outdoor tents globe occurred in the 1970s when a focus on movement and simplicity of use drove suppliers to experiment with synthetic fabrics like nylon. This transformation led to modern-day outdoors tents that maintain weather resistance and sturdiness while minimizing weight, dimension, and arrangement time.

Products
The products utilized to make a canvas wall tent will certainly have a considerable effect on the quality and longevity of the sanctuary. In the past, a lot of canvas was made from cotton or hemp - now it can be made from either natural or artificial fibers.

A high-grade canvas is woven securely and has long fibers for exceptional strength and durability. This makes it able to stand up versus severe weather and uncertain problems. It is also breathable, which helps in reducing condensation that can endanger your instant comfort and bring about mildew or mold in the future.

A high quality canvas will additionally be treated with anti-mildew, water repellent and fire resistant chemicals. A visual examination is the very best way to establish whether a fabric is high-grade. A lower-quality canvas might appear glossy and thick, however it will not last as lengthy or carry out along with a higher-quality material. Functions
For many exterior lovers, one of the most crucial tent floor feature of an outdoor tents is its ability to take care of severe problems and altering weather patterns. Canvas wall surface tents have an all-natural heavy-duty high quality that stands up to high winds, rainfalls, and snow, making them ideal for seekers who commonly set up base camps in sturdy terrain while tracking their victim.

The frame of a canvas camping tent is another crucial component to think about. Steel structures offer the best sturdiness and security, but light weight aluminum frames are likewise an excellent choice for those that may not prepare to relocate their tent often.

The type of material made use of in a canvas tent is likewise important. Typically, outdoor tents fabrics were treated with oils, pet fats, or waxes to drive away moisture. Today, a lot of are treated with silicone or polyurethane finishes that use reliable waterproofing. The best canvas outdoors tents are breathable and allow air to distribute, aiding regulate temperatures and minimize condensation. Many have actually evaluated windows and vents that can be opened up for optimum ventilation on hot summertime days, or near maintain heat in colder environments.
